New publication alert! 𧬠A team of Pitt computational biologists and virologists built a detailed model of how Eastern equine encephalitis virus rapidly hijacks host cells to replicate. Check it out in PLOS Computational Biology.

Graduate Spotlight: Ali Tugrul Balci, PhD '24
When Ali Tugrul Balci moved from Istanbul to Pittsburgh, he didnβt expect to find a second home. But through his PhD program, he discovered both a supportive community and a passion for #computationalbiology research. Read more in our graduate spotlight story: tinyurl.com/AliTugrulBalci
